Dhaharpur Population - Paschim Medinipur, West Bengal

Dhaharpur is a large village located in Narayangarh Block of Paschim Medinipur district, West Bengal with total 722 families residing. The Dhaharpur village has population of 3200 of which 1625 are males while 1575 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Dhaharpur village population of children with age 0-6 is 424 which makes up 13.25 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Dhaharpur village is 969 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Dhaharpur as per census is 910, lower than West Bengal average of 956.

Dhaharpur village has higher liter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Dhaharpur village was 77.77 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Dhaharpur Male literacy stands at 85.25 % while female literacy rate was 70.14 %.

Caste Factor

In Dhaharpur village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 59.97 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 13.84 % of total population in Dhaharpur village.

Work Profile

In Dhaharpur village out of total population, 1610 were engaged in work activities. 55.65 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 44.35 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1610 workers engaged in Main Work, 207 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 340 were Agricultural labourer.
